For the past 47 years, The Black Rose has been Boston’s premier Irish pub and restaurant. Located in the heart of Boston’s historic Faneuil Hall and steps from the city’s celebrated waterfront, The Black Rose has been serving up perfect pints of Guinness and traditional Irish fare 365 days a year since 1976. It’s a beloved Boston institution, prompting the Boston Globe to call it “The Fenway Park of Irish pubs.
